Eva is a high-class call girl who is entirely indifferent to Tyvian’s ego, fame, or affection. She is motivated solely by money and a desire to humiliate the men who try to possess her. Tyvian becomes obsessively ensnared in her games, leading to a brutal downward spiral of masochism and moral degradation.

The film was famously released under different titles, including Eve in the UK and The Devil's Woman in the US. For the best experience, seek out the Indicator Blu-ray which includes multiple versions, including the longest known 126-minute cut.
